Introducción
Pasarse a Amazon Web Services (AWS) puede suponer cambios para las empresas, ya que ofrece diversas ventajas, como mayor escalabilidad, mejor rendimiento y rentabilidad. Sin embargo, el proceso de transición puede ser intrincado. Viene con su conjunto de obstáculos. Para garantizar un cambio, las empresas deben adoptar métodos a medida que se adapten a sus requisitos específicos. Este artículo profundiza en las estrategias para una migración a AWS y ofrece información valiosa para ayudar a las organizaciones a navegar eficazmente por este proceso crucial.
Comprender sus objetivos de migración
Antes de comenzar una migración a AWS, es esencial que comprenda sus objetivos de migración. Estos objetivos le servirán de brújula para planificar y tomar decisiones a lo largo del proceso de migración:
- Definir sus objetivos. Comience por identificar los objetivos que pretende alcanzar con la migración a AWS. Ya se trate de reducir los costes, mejorar la escalabilidad, reforzar la seguridad o aumentar el rendimiento, los objetivos definidos ayudarán a elaborar un plan de migración.
- Evaluar su infraestructura actual. Realice una evaluación de su infraestructura informática actual para conocer su estado. Esto implica evaluar aplicaciones, cargas de trabajo, conjuntos de datos y dependencias. Esta evaluación ayudará a determinar el enfoque de la migración y a identificar posibles obstáculos.
Elegir la estrategia de migración adecuada
La elección de la estrategia de migración es fundamental para la transición a AWS.
Diferentes necesidades requieren estrategias y la elección del enfoque depende de sus objetivos, los recursos disponibles y el calendario.
Las seis erres de la migración
AWS describe seis estrategias de migración conocidas como las "Seis R":
-
Rehosting (elevación y desplazamiento): Traslado de aplicaciones, con modificaciones.
-
Replanteamiento (Lift, Tinker and Shift): Realizar optimizaciones para obtener beneficios tangibles.
-
Recompra: Transición a un producto a través de un modelo SaaS.
-
Refactorización/Rearquitectura: Replanteamiento de cómo se estructura y desarrolla una aplicación mediante funcionalidades.
-
Retirarse: Cierre de aplicaciones que ya no son necesarias.
-
Conservar: Conservar las aplicaciones que no se pueden mover.
Por ejemplo, una plataforma de comercio electrónico podría optar por volver a hospedar su aplicación web para una transición a AWS y, al mismo tiempo, renovar su sistema de gestión de inventario para aprovechar eficazmente las capacidades de escalabilidad y rendimiento de AWS.
La plataforma todo en uno para un SEO eficaz
Detrás de todo negocio de éxito hay una sólida campaña de SEO. Pero con las innumerables herramientas y técnicas de optimización que existen para elegir, puede ser difícil saber por dónde empezar. Bueno, no temas más, porque tengo justo lo que necesitas. Presentamos la plataforma todo en uno Ranktracker para un SEO eficaz
¡Por fin hemos abierto el registro a Ranktracker totalmente gratis!
Crear una cuenta gratuitaO inicia sesión con tus credenciales
Enfoque híbrido
En algunos casos, una estrategia híbrida que combine enfoques puede ofrecer la solución más eficaz. Esto permite a las empresas trasladar cargas de trabajo a AWS y mantener al mismo tiempo parte de la infraestructura local, por ejemplo. Una gran empresa podría trasladar sus aplicaciones de cara al cliente a AWS por motivos de acceso y escalabilidad, mientras mantiene sus aplicaciones de datos in situ para cumplir la normativa.
Planificar y ejecutar la migración
Trazar y llevar a cabo el proceso de migración a AWS es crucial para reducir las interrupciones y garantizar la transición. Esto implica la planificación del proyecto, las pruebas y la implementación de los cambios, por etapas.
1. Planificación minuciosa del proyecto
Elabore un plan de proyecto que describa cada etapa del proceso de migración. Incluya plazos, recursos, funciones y responsabilidades. El plan también debe cubrir la gestión de riesgos y las estrategias de copia de seguridad.
2. Migración de prueba
Comience con una migración de prueba para comprobar su estrategia a escala. Esto ayuda a identificar problemas y le permite perfeccionar su enfoque antes de migrar las cargas de trabajo. Por ejemplo, una institución financiera podría realizar una migración de prueba de aplicaciones esenciales a AWS, supervisando de cerca el desempeño y los detalles de seguridad antes de proceder con el cambio completo.
3. Aplicación por etapas
Realice la migración gradualmente por etapas para gestionar la complejidad de forma eficaz y minimizar el tiempo de inactividad. Comience por migrar primero las aplicaciones y, a continuación, pase progresivamente a las más críticas a medida que aumente la confianza en el proceso. Una empresa de medios de comunicación puede comenzar transfiriendo su sistema de gestión de contenidos a AWS, seguido de su plataforma de streaming de vídeo. Es fundamental asegurarse de que cada fase es estable y totalmente funcional antes de pasar a la siguiente.
Mejorar el rendimiento tras la migración
Tras migrar a AWS, es importante centrarse en optimizar el desempeño para aprovechar al máximo los beneficios de la plataforma. Esto incluye la monitorización del rendimiento, la gestión eficaz de los costes y la mejora continua de la configuración de la nube.
1. Supervisión y optimización del rendimiento
Utilice herramientas de monitorización de AWS como CloudWatch y CloudTrail para realizar un seguimiento del rendimiento y la seguridad de las aplicaciones. Regularmente. Ajuste con precisión su entorno en la nube para alinearlo con sus objetivos de rendimiento al tiempo que mantiene los costes bajo control. Las empresas de comercio electrónico podrían utilizar CloudWatch para supervisar el rendimiento de las aplicaciones. Al identificar los cuellos de botella y optimizar los recursos, pueden mejorar los tiempos de carga y la experiencia general del usuario.
2. Gestión de costes
Implemente estrategias eficaces de gestión de costos para evitar gastos. Aproveche herramientas como AWS Cost Explorer y Trusted Advisor para analizar las tendencias de gasto e identificar las áreas en las que se pueden ahorrar costes. Por ejemplo, una startup tecnológica podría establecer alertas de costes. Utilizar instancias reservadas para cargas de trabajo a fin de administrar mejor sus gastos de AWS.
3. Mejora continua
Adopte una cultura de mejora, reevaluando y actualizando su estrategia en la nube. Manténgase al día de los servicios y funcionalidades de migración de AWS que pueden enriquecer su entorno en la nube. Una empresa que desarrolla software puede evaluar periódicamente su estructura en la nube integrando nuevas características de AWS como Lambda para la informática sin servidor o S3 Glacier, para el almacenamiento de datos de coste.
Resumen
Pasarse a AWS tiene sus ventajas. Su éxito depende de una planificación minuciosa, una ejecución impecable y un perfeccionamiento continuo. Al comprender sus objetivos de migración, seleccionar el enfoque, planificar meticulosamente con antelación y optimizar después de la migración, su empresa puede aprovechar al máximo las capacidades de AWS. La adopción de estas estrategias garantiza una transición que permitirá a su organización destacar en la era de la informática en la nube.